Transaction 23a428bc59bed6c61f061195ade2f771392e42aeea014e5f4711f71946bca8eb

1 Input
2 Outputs
  • 23a428bc59bed6c61f061195ade2f771392e42aeea014e5f4711f71946bca8eb:0
  • value  749166
    address  1FyAZPgiDXuTZHhjsFhqrv1tuSyr5Wz56a
  • 23a428bc59bed6c61f061195ade2f771392e42aeea014e5f4711f71946bca8eb:1
  • value  1264123
    address  37Xgcw7fRdzUdhYMgTTPbxLHUcHUsMMpsy